Understanding the Basics of VIN Lookup

At its core, VIN lookup involves decoding the alphanumeric sequence embedded within the VIN to reveal critical information about a vehicle’s history and specifications. The VIN typically consists of 17 characters, each providing insights into various aspects of the vehicle, including its manufacturer, model year, place of assembly, and more.

Unveiling Vehicle Histories

One of the primary functions of VIN lookup is to unveil the history of a vehicle. By accessing databases maintained by government agencies, insurance companies, and other organizations, individuals can retrieve vital information such as past ownership records, accident history, title status, and odometer readings. This transparency allows potential buyers to make informed decisions and mitigate the risks associated with purchasing a used car.

Detecting Fraudulent Activities

VIN lookup also plays a crucial role in detecting fraudulent activities such as odometer tampering, title washing, and vehicle cloning. By cross-referencing the information obtained through VIN lookup with official records and databases, consumers and law enforcement agencies can identify discrepancies and red flags that may indicate potential scams or illegal practices.

Navigating the VIN Decoding Process

Deciphering the VIN may seem like a daunting task, but it follows a standardized format established by the International Organization for Standardization (ISO). Each character in the VIN corresponds to a specific piece of information about the vehicle, such as the manufacturer, vehicle type, engine type, and model year. Numerous online resources and VIN decoding tools are available to streamline this process and provide users with accurate and detailed insights into a vehicle’s background.
